Thorough planning is imperative to help achieve the optimum end product for each Client.
Although a yacht is a product to be used to gain great pleasure and relaxation, as with a business it requires the correct management to minimise losses and improve gains.
Nobody who builds or owns a yacht wishes to see their hard-earned money being mismanaged and effectively thrown away.
Hence, when you decide to build, carefully consider what you are expecting as the end product. Is it global cruising, ‘green’, speed, private use or charter and how you would like that project to be managed to achieve that goal.
What route would you prefer to take to find your perfect yacht and which yard to build it for you?
Do you want to have the help of a large brokerage house or would you prefer a smaller independent (‘YachtFinder’) to advise you and work with your legal counsel.
Then consider the team you will have around to help protect you.
You will need the help of those who understand the industry you are about to get involved in, such as but not limited to:
- Marine Lawyers
- Technical Consultants / Owners Representatives
- Company Structure specialists
- VAT advisers
- Insurance advisers
- Yacht Management Company
- Charter Broker (if commercial).
Ensure that you get your team in place before you sign the build contract. Have your Technical Consultant /Owners Representative undertake a thorough Specification and GAP review. This is to ensure that all clauses in the Specification are to the highest possible standards and that the GAP meets Regulatory requirements, is functional and will allow optimal Client comfort and safety.
By ensuring a through Specification review prior to contract signing you can reduce the risk of increased expenditure through multiple VTC’s (Variations to Contract) during the build.
It’s not about having the best equipment (which in itself is a subjective topic) but more that the equipment supplied (and agreed in the contract) is installed in such a way that it meets the Manufacturers requirements and can be easily accessed for maintenance.
This will save the Client substantial costs in the long term.
As with any business, different concepts require different approaches.
Whether you are considering a Production yacht, a Semi-custom yacht or a full Custom build yacht the approach will differ.
Depending on the size and intended use of the vessel it may be required to meet Classification, Code orFlag regulations (SOLAS, MARPOL, IMO) in which case the Client team will need to ensure these are adhered to.
Generally a Production yacht will have less Owners team input than a Semi-custom or Custom yacht.
Owning and running a yacht is an expensive business. Vessel operation budgets are high and every bit of maintenance costs more than a similar item on a land based project.
If you build a yacht without an Owners Representative you risk poor system installation, late delivery of the vessel, increased build costs (multiple VTC’s) and future increased operation costs.
On top of that who will inspect and sign off for the installation of: Machinery, Plumbing, Electrics,Electronics, Paint systems, Carpentry as well as quality checks of the stainless steel, teak decking and sea-fastening systems (to name a few).
An experienced Owners Representative and Technical Consultant will be able to help reduce these costs, by working with the yard, to improve system installation, monitor the build schedule (Yard schedule plus Owners Supply schedule), check all of the above mentioned items and more whilst reducing VTC’s and in turn operating costs.
